Yeongjun Lee is a scholar working on Electrical and Electronic Engineering, Biomedical Engineering and Polymers and Plastics. According to data from OpenAlex, Yeongjun Lee has authored 52 papers receiving a total of 6.2k indexed citations (citations by other indexed papers that have themselves been cited), including 33 papers in Electrical and Electronic Engineering, 29 papers in Biomedical Engineering and 23 papers in Polymers and Plastics. Recurrent topics in Yeongjun Lee’s work include Advanced Sensor and Energy Harvesting Materials (27 papers), Conducting polymers and applications (22 papers) and Advanced Memory and Neural Computing (17 papers). Yeongjun Lee is often cited by papers focused on Advanced Sensor and Energy Harvesting Materials (27 papers), Conducting polymers and applications (22 papers) and Advanced Memory and Neural Computing (17 papers). Yeongjun Lee collaborates with scholars based in South Korea, United States and China. Yeongjun Lee's co-authors include Tae‐Woo Lee, Yeongin Kim, Zhenan Bao, Jin Young Oh, Jiheong Kang, Donghee Son, Yuxin Liu, Wentao Xu, Jeffrey B.‐H. Tok and Hea‐Lim Park and has published in prestigious journals such as Science, Advanced Materials and Nature Communications.
